Algorithms-Explanation: Easy Algo Explanations

Algorithms-Explanation provides clear explanations, examples, and implementation links for various algorithms, supporting multiple programming languages for comprehensive learning and reference.
Screenshot of TheAlgorithms/Algorithms-Explanation homepage

Algorithms-Explanation aims to simplify the understanding of fundamental algorithms. The project provides accessible explanations, code examples, and links to implementations across popular programming languages like Python, Java, and C++. It addresses the need for a centralized resource for learning and applying algorithms in software development. The project utilizes a language-based structure to facilitate multilingual access to the explanations.

This project distinguishes itself through its comprehensive coverage of algorithms across various programming languages and languages. It offers practical code examples and direct links to implementations, accelerating the learning process. The multilingual support enhances accessibility for a global audience. The project has a clear structure that facilitates navigation and understanding of different algorithms.

  • Algorithm Explanations: Provides detailed explanations of various algorithms, including time and space complexity analysis.
  • Code Examples: Offers implementations in multiple programming languages for practical understanding.
  • Language Support: Supports explanations in numerous languages, making it accessible to a wide audience.
  • Resource Links: Links to relevant documentation, tutorials, and further learning materials.
  • Language Structure: Organizes content by language, simplifying navigation and targeted learning.
  • Clear Organization: Presents algorithms in a structured manner, facilitating easy comprehension.
  • Community Contributions: Encourages contributions for expanding the range of covered algorithms and languages.

The project has been actively maintained since 2017, with a steady stream of updates and additions. It has a substantial number of stars and forks, indicating community interest and usage. Regular commits suggest ongoing development and maintenance. The documentation is relatively complete, and a community forum (Gitter) exists for support and discussion. The established presence and continued activity suggest a reliable resource.

This project is valuable for developers and learners seeking a comprehensive resource for algorithm knowledge. It facilitates understanding, practical implementation, and cross-language comparison. It offers a significant advantage over scattered online resources by providing a curated, organized collection of algorithm explanations and implementations. This supports improved problem-solving skills and more efficient software development.
